New order for M3 - Need suggestions
Hi All,
I ordered my BMW M3 MW on February 27th. My dealer said I can change till March 4th and then its get locked. They ran my credit check when I placed the order and I gave $1000 as deposit as well. Till today, I don't see check being deposited by the dealer nor I have received the production number ... Could any one tell me how long does it take to receive the production number once you place an order? Thanks in advance...![]() |

My best understanding is no production number means your dealer doesn't have an allocation for a car yet (e.g. no production with your name on it yet). Doesn't mean you won't get a car, but it means right now the burden is on them to find you a slot.
I think you get a production number at status 111 (order accepted by BMW). I'd be a little concerned given slots are becoming pretty scarce with EOP in June. |

production number should be given to you no more than 5 days after you put down your deposit. I asked the dealer to put in writing they would hand me a production number right after I provided my deposit, suffice to say I got mine by end-of-day. Car arrived 6 weeks later.
no production number up to this point is concerning.
